What to Seek in a Superior Health Food Store
When seeking a health food store that aligns with your values and dietary needs, several key factors should be considered. These include the quality of products offered, the variety of selection, the expertise of the staff, and the overall environment of the store.
Quality of Products: A Foundation for Wellness
The cornerstone of any reputable health food store is the quality of its products. Look for stores that prioritize organic certification and labeling transparency. A commitment to organic practices ensures that the food you purchase is free from harmful pesticides, herbicides, and genetically modified organisms (GMOs). It’s also important to note the freshness of produce and other perishable items. A store that prioritizes locally sourced or seasonal produce is likely to offer items that are both fresher and more nutrient-dense. Also, a good store should offer a selection of natural and minimally processed foods, avoiding artificial colors, flavors, and preservatives.

Co-ops: A Community-Owned Approach to Healthy Food
Food cooperatives are member-owned businesses that prioritize community needs over profits. Co-ops typically offer a wide selection of organic, natural, and locally sourced products at competitive prices. Becoming a member of a co-op gives you a voice in how the business is run and allows you to support a more sustainable food system.

Tips for Healthy Shopping at Any Store
Regardless of where you choose to shop, there are several key strategies that can help you make healthier choices and support a more sustainable food system.
Read Labels Carefully: Understanding What You’re Eating
Pay close attention to ingredient lists and nutrition facts labels. Look for products with minimal added sugars, salt, and unhealthy fats. Be aware of artificial ingredients and processed foods.
Plan Your Meals: Making Informed Choices
Planning your meals in advance can help you avoid impulse purchases and focus on healthy choices. Create a shopping list based on your meal plan and stick to it.
Shop the Perimeter: Prioritizing Fresh Foods
The perimeter of most grocery stores is where you’ll find the fresh produce, lean proteins, and whole grains. Spend most of your time in these sections and limit your exposure to the processed foods in the center aisles.
Buy in Bulk: Saving Money and Reducing Waste
Buying staples like grains, nuts, and seeds in bulk can save you money and reduce packaging waste.
Cook at Home: Controlling Ingredients and Portion Sizes
Cooking your own meals is the best way to control the ingredients you consume and ensure that you’re eating a healthy, balanced diet.
